Sandisk Has Surged More Than 3,000% in 12 Months. Is a Stock Split Coming?

Sandisk has become a prime stock-split candidate after an extraordinary 3,000%+ rally pushed its share price into quadruple digits, even though the company has not announced any plans.

A stock split wouldn't change Sandisk's business or its value.

The real investment story remains AI-driven memory demand, with Sandisk's long-term performance depending on continued strength in NAND pricing and data center demand.

If any stock looks like a textbook candidate for a split right now, it is Sandisk (NASDAQ: SNDK) . The ticker has been on a massive tear: Shares have surged more than 3,000% in roughly 12 months, going from around $50 at the time of its spinoff from Western Digital to a 52โ€‘week high above $2,350, and they still trade in the lowโ€‘ to mid four figures today. That kind of move puts Sandisk in rare territory and raises a reasonable question: Does management eventually decide to cut the share price into more digestible pieces?

A stock split is simple mechanically. If a company declares a 10โ€‘forโ€‘1 split, every shareholder gets 10 shares for each one they own, and the price per share drops by a factor of 10. If Sandisk were trading at $1,500 before a 10โ€‘forโ€‘1 split, it would open around $150 afterward. The company's market value does not change, nor does your percentage ownership. You just own more, lowerโ€‘priced shares instead of fewer, highโ€‘priced ones.
